This community is for those with (or think they have) schizoid personality disorder (spd). Also welcome are those who know of schizoid types... and I guess the list could go on for anyone who has some interest in SPD. - [info]aberwak (group maintainer)


"Schizoid personality disorder is primarily characterized by a very limited range of emotion, both in expression of and experiencing. Persons with this disorder are indifferent to social relationships and display flattened affect." -PSYweb

"Schizoid personality disorder (SPD) is a personality disorder characterised by a lack of interest in social relationships, a tendency towards a solitary lifestyle, and emotional coldness." -Wikipedia: Schizoid Personality Disorder
